Abstract

This research discusses and describes the phrase or sentence containing of particularized conversational implicature used by the characters in Netflix’ On My Block TV series and then the meanings are explained. The researcher uses Grice (1975) theory about Implicature for analyzing the particularized conversational implicature. In conducting research, the researcher uses descriptive qualitative method to describe and identify the particularized conversational implicature, without using any quantitative method in the analysis. The data in this research are collected by watching the series and transcribes the dialogues. Then the selected data are analyzed one by one, by using the theory of implicature. The result of analysis are the researcher found 13 data. The result of analysis shows that the particularized conversational implicature is related to the context of american culture and language. This specific context makes the viewers understand the implied meaning.
